Thermooncology

Hyperthermia is a promising cancer treatment aiming to elevate tumor temperature and destroy cancer cells, enhancing local control. Often used alongside radiotherapy or chemotherapy, it demonstrates versatility in addressing various cancers like breast cancer, melanoma, and sarcoma. By selectively targeting cancer cells with controlled heat (40-45°C), hyperthermia capitalizes on their heightened sensitivity. The integration of hyperthermia with traditional treatments offers synergistic effects, improving their efficacy. Ongoing research seeks to optimize protocols and address challenges for broader application.
